Understanding the Role of an Accident Claim Attorney

An accident claim attorney specializes in representing customers who have actually sustained injuries due to the negligence or wrongdoing of others. Their main goal is to assist victims get monetary compensation for their losses, which might consist of:

  • Medical costs
  • Lost salaries
  • Pain and suffering
  • Residential or commercial property damage

The Claims Process: What to Expect

The claims procedure can be elaborate and requires mindful navigation to accomplish a beneficial result. Below is a step-by-step overview of how an accident claim normally unfolds:

  1. Initial Consultation: During this conference, the attorney evaluates the case, discusses the details of the accident, and identifies the viability of suing.

  2. Examination: The attorney carries out a comprehensive investigation, collecting evidence, interviewing witnesses, and obtaining necessary documents, such as medical records and authorities reports.

  3. Need Letter: Once the examination is complete, the attorney prepares a need letter detailing the circumstances of the accident, the injuries sustained, and the compensation looked for.

  4. Settlement: The attorney takes part in negotiations with the insurer to reach a settlement. The majority of claims are fixed during this phase without requiring to go to trial.

  5. Submitting a Lawsuit: If a fair settlement can not be achieved, the attorney might file a lawsuit in court. This involves extra paperwork and adherence to particular due dates.

  6. Trial: If the case proceeds to trial, the attorney presents the case before a judge or jury, promoting on behalf of the client.

  7. Getting Compensation: Once a verdict is reached or a settlement is concurred upon, the attorney will assist ensure that compensation is gotten.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. How much does an accident claim attorney cost?Most accident claim lawyers deal with a contingency charge basis, meaning they just make money if you win your case. Typically, this cost ranges from 25%to 40%of the settlement quantity. 2. For how long do I have to submit an accident claim?The statute of

restrictions for submitting an accident claim differs by state but generally varies from one to 3 years. It's vital to consult an attorney as quickly as possible after an accident. 3. What if I was partly at fault for the accident?Many specifies follow a comparative neglect

rule, which suggests that even if you are partly at fault, you
may still be entitled to compensation. Your award will be minimized by your percentage of fault. 4. Do I require an attorney for a small accident?While not always essential for minor accidents, having an attorney can assist ensure you receive reasonable compensation,even for relatively small claims. 5. What need to I do
instantly after an accident?Seek medical attention, gather evidence(pictures, witness details), report the accident to the authorities or your insurance provider, and
